We’re Trying to Create a One Stop Shop Experience for Tax Payers
NASSAU, BAHAMAS – With business license renewal season officially underway, the Department of Inland Revenue is aiming to simplify the process for thousands of Bahamians through its recurring outreach initiative, “DIR Comes to You.”
